Ja. Aber es ist dein Job. Das Schreiben eines Algorithmus ist nicht besonders schwierig, aber Backtesting und Debugging des Algorithmus, so dass es nicht nur geleert Ihr Bankkonto. Sie werden eine Menge Anstrengung Tests, Raffination und Debugging Ihre Algorithmus zu verbringen, und Sie werden wahrscheinlich weniger Kapital, das bedeutet, dass Ihre Gesamtrenditen werden niedriger sein. Aber wenn du es nicht tust, ist es. 1) die meisten Menschen mit der Fähigkeit, algo Handel tun können mehr Geld mit weniger Aufwand machen andere Dinge zu tun. Algo-Handel ist eine Menge harter Arbeit, und die meisten Menschen können mehr Geld mit dem gleichen Aufwand machen etwas anderes zu tun. 2) wenn Sie für jemand anderes arbeiten, und Sie völlig durcheinander bringen, erhalten Sie gefeuert, aber Sie ve ihr Geld und nicht verkaufen. Die Grundlagen des Forex Algorithmic Trading Fast vor dreißig Jahren war der Devisenmarkt (Forex) durch Trades über Telefon, institutionelle Investoren geprägt. Undurchsichtige Preisinformationen, eine klare Trennung zwischen Interdealer-Handel und Händler-Kunden-Handel und geringe Marktkonzentration. Heute haben technologische Fortschritte den Markt verändert. Trades werden in erster Linie über Computer, so dass Einzelhändlern in den Markt eintreten, haben Echtzeit-Streaming-Preise zu mehr Transparenz geführt und die Unterscheidung zwischen Händlern und ihren anspruchsvollsten Kunden ist weitgehend verschwunden. Eine besonders wichtige Änderung ist die Einführung des algorithmischen Handels. Die, während bedeutende Verbesserungen der Funktionsweise des Devisenhandels, stellt auch eine Reihe von Risiken. Durch die Betrachtung der Grundlagen der Forex-Markt und algorithmischen Handel, werden wir einige Vorteile algorithmischen Handel hat zum Devisenhandel gebracht, während auch auf einige der Risiken. Forex Basics Forex ist der virtuelle Ort, an dem Währungspaare in unterschiedlichen Volumina nach festgelegten Preisen gehandelt werden, wobei eine Basiswährung einen Preis in Form einer Quotierungswährung erhält. Betrieb 24 Stunden am Tag, fünf Tage die Woche, Forex gilt als weltweit größte und liquide Finanzmarkt. Nach der Bank für Internationalen Zahlungsausgleich (BIZ) lag das tägliche weltweite durchschnittliche Handelsvolumen im April 2013 bei 2,0 Billionen. Der Großteil dieses Handels ist für US-Dollar, Euro und japanischen Yen erfolgt und umfasst eine Reihe von Spielern, darunter private Banken, Zentralbanken, Pensionskassen. Institutionelle Anleger, Großkonzerne, Finanzgesellschaften und Einzelhändler. Obwohl spekulative Handel die Hauptmotivation für bestimmte Investoren sein kann, ist der Hauptgrund für die Existenz des Forex-Marktes, dass die Menschen Währungen handeln müssen, um ausländische Waren und Dienstleistungen zu kaufen. Die Aktivität auf dem Forex-Markt wirkt sich auf die realen Wechselkurse aus und kann daher den Output, die Beschäftigung, die Inflation und die Kapitalströme einer bestimmten Nation tief greifen. Aus diesem Grund haben Politiker, die Öffentlichkeit und die Medien alle ein Interesse an dem, was auf dem Forex-Markt geht. Grundlagen des algorithmischen Handels Ein Algorithmus ist im Wesentlichen eine Reihe von spezifischen Regeln entworfen, um eine klar definierte Aufgabe abzuschließen. Im Finanzmarkthandel führen Computer benutzerdefinierte Algorithmen durch, die durch eine Reihe von Regeln, die aus Parametern wie Timing, Preis oder Menge, die Struktur der Trades, die gemacht werden, bestehen. Es gibt vier grundlegende Arten von algorithmischen Handel auf den Finanzmärkten: statistische, Auto-Hedging, algorithmische Ausführungsstrategien und direkten Marktzugang. Statistisch bezieht sich auf eine algorithmische Strategie, die auf der Grundlage der statistischen Analyse der historischen Zeitreihendaten nach rentablen Handelsmöglichkeiten sucht. Auto-Hedging ist eine Strategie, die Regeln erzeugt, um das Risiko eines Händlers zu minimieren. Das Ziel der algorithmischen Umsetzung Strategien ist es, ein vorgegebenes Ziel, wie z. B. Verringerung der Auswirkungen auf den Markt oder führen Sie einen Handel schnell. Schließlich beschreibt der direkte Marktzugang die optimalen Geschwindigkeiten und niedrigeren Kosten, auf die algorithmische Händler Zugriff haben und auf mehrere Handelsplattformen zugreifen können. Eine der Unterkategorien des algorithmischen Handels ist der Hochfrequenzhandel, der durch die extrem hohe Häufigkeit von Handelsaufträgen gekennzeichnet ist. High-Speed-Handel kann bedeutende Vorteile für Händler, indem sie ihnen die Fähigkeit, Geschäfte in Millisekunden von inkrementalen Preisänderungen zu machen. Aber es kann auch bestimmte Risiken mit sich bringen. Algorithmischer Handel im Forex-Markt Ein Großteil des Wachstums des algorithmischen Handels in den Devisenmärkten der vergangenen Jahre ist auf Algorithmen zurückzuführen, die bestimmte Prozesse automatisieren und die zur Durchführung von Devisentransaktionen benötigten Stunden reduzieren. Die Effizienz der Automatisierung führt zu niedrigeren Kosten bei der Durchführung dieser Prozesse. Ein solches Verfahren ist die Ausführung von Handelsaufträgen. Das Automatisieren des Handelsprozesses mit einem Algorithmus, der auf vorher festgelegten Kriterien beruht, wie beispielsweise das Ausführen von Aufträgen über eine bestimmte Zeitspanne oder zu einem bestimmten Preis, ist wesentlich effizienter als die manuelle Ausführung durch den Menschen. Banken haben auch die Vorteile von Algorithmen genutzt, die programmiert sind, um die Preise von Währungspaaren auf elektronischen Handelsplattformen zu aktualisieren. Diese Algorithmen erhöhen die Geschwindigkeit, mit der die Banken Marktpreise zitieren und gleichzeitig die Anzahl der manuellen Arbeitsstunden reduzieren können, die zur Preisangabe erforderlich sind. Einige Banken programmieren Algorithmen, um ihr Risiko zu reduzieren. Die Algorithmen können verwendet werden, um eine bestimmte Währung zu verkaufen, um einem Kundenhandel zu entsprechen, in dem die Bank den Gegenwert gekauft hat, um eine konstante Menge dieser bestimmten Währung aufrechtzuerhalten. Dies ermöglicht es der Bank, eine vorab festgelegte Risikoposition für diese Währung zu halten. Diese Prozesse wurden durch Algorithmen deutlich effizienter, was zu niedrigeren Transaktionskosten führt. Dennoch sind diese nicht die einzigen Faktoren, die das Wachstum im Forex algorithmischen Handel treiben. Algorithmen werden zunehmend für den spekulativen Handel verwendet, da die Kombination von Hochfrequenz und die Fähigkeit des Algorithmus, Daten zu interpretieren und Aufträge auszuführen, es den Händlern ermöglicht haben, Arbitragemöglichkeiten zu nutzen, die sich aus kleinen Preisabweichungen zwischen Währungspaaren ergeben. Alle diese Vorteile haben zu einer verstärkten Nutzung von Algorithmen im Forex-Markt geführt, aber lassen Sie uns auf einige der Risiken, die algorithmischen Handel begleiten zu suchen. Risiken im algorithmischen Forex Trading beteiligt Obwohl algorithmischen Handel hat viele Verbesserungen gemacht, gibt es einige Nachteile, die die Stabilität und Liquidität des Forex-Marktes bedrohen könnte. Ein solcher Nachteil betrifft Ungleichgewichte der Handelskraft der Marktteilnehmer. Einige Teilnehmer haben die Mittel, um eine ausgeklügelte Technologie zu erwerben, die es ihnen ermöglicht, Informationen zu erhalten und Aufträge mit einer viel schnelleren Geschwindigkeit auszuführen als andere. Dieses Ungleichgewicht zwischen Haves and Have-Nots in Bezug auf die anspruchsvollste algorithmische Technologie könnte zu einer Fragmentierung innerhalb des Marktes führen, die zu Liquiditätsengpässen im Laufe der Zeit führen kann. Darüber hinaus gibt es grundlegende Unterschiede zwischen den Aktienmärkten und dem Forex-Markt gibt es einige, die befürchten, dass der Hochfrequenz-Handel, der den Börsen-Blitz-Absturz am 6. Mai 2010 verschärft könnte ähnlich beeinflussen den Forex-Markt. Da Algorithmen für spezifische Marktszenarien programmiert werden, können sie nicht schnell genug reagieren, wenn sich der Markt drastisch verändert. Um dieses Szenario zu vermeiden, müssen die Märkte überwacht und das algorithmische Handel während der Marktturbulenzen ausgesetzt werden. Allerdings könnte in solchen Extremszenarien eine gleichzeitige Aussetzung des algorithmischen Handels durch zahlreiche Marktteilnehmer zu einer hohen Volatilität und einer drastischen Verringerung der Marktliquidität führen. Die Bottom Line Obwohl algorithmischen Handel wurde in der Lage, die Effizienz zu steigern, wodurch die Kosten für den Handel Währungen, hat es auch mit einigen zusätzlichen Risiken gekommen. Damit Währungen ordnungsgemäß funktionieren, müssen sie einigermaßen stabile Wertpapiere sein und hochflüssig sein. Daher ist es wichtig, dass der Forex-Markt mit niedrigen Preisvolatilität flüssig bleiben. Wie alle Lebensbereiche bringt die neue Technologie viele Vorteile mit sich, bringt aber auch neue Risiken mit sich. Die Herausforderung für die Zukunft der algorithmischen Forex-Handel wird, wie man Veränderungen, die den Nutzen maximieren und gleichzeitig die Risiken zu reduzieren. Real-World-Beispiele Mit AlgoTrader kann jede regelbasierte Handelsstrategie automatisiert werden, wie die folgenden Beispiele aus der Praxis zeigen: Mittel - bis langfristige Trendfolgen (CTA) Unser Mandant handelt von einem klassischen, aber sehr effizienten Beispiel dieser bekannten Gruppe Der systematischen Handelsstrategien. Es handelt sich um eine große Anzahl von Basiswerten, die praktisch alle Assetklassen umfassen, wobei die notwendigen Handelssignale aus den täglichen Kursinstruktionen abgeleitet werden. In Anbetracht der umfangreichen Nutzung der künftigen Verträge durch diese Strategie wurden anspruchsvolle Rollmechanismen entwickelt, die für die einzelnen Vermögenswerte spezifisch sind. Multi-Indikator Forex-Handel Dieser Kunde konzentriert sich auf Forex-Spot-Handel und beschäftigt eine Intraday-Strategie auf einer Reihe von technischen Indikatoren basiert. Während einige dieser Indikatoren zeitbezogen sind, können andere einen Handel zu jeder Zeit während der Sitzung auslösen. Der reine Intraday-Charakter der Strategie erfordert, dass alle Positionen geschlossen werden, bevor der Markt schließt. AlgoTrader stellt sicher, dass dies jeden Tag passiert. Option Arbitrage Dieses Modell handelt von einer Vielzahl von Optionen, sowohl aufgelistet als auch OTC, basierend auf verschiedenen Basiswerten. Es muss also unterschiedliche Eingaben, wie z. B. benutzerdefinierte Volatilitätsflächen, berücksichtigen und aggregieren. Die Bausteine der Strategie sind Kombinationen von Instrumenten wie Drosseln, Schmetterlingen und komplexeren, kundenspezifischen Derivat-Spreads, die das System als einzige Position zu behandeln hat. Dazu schafft AlgoTrader synthetische Positionen, die alle notwendigen Informationen aus ihren Bestandteilen zusammenfassen. Equity Statistisches Arbitrage Dieses hochfrequente Handelsmodell sucht kontinuierlich kurzfristige Preisdiskrepanzen an verschiedenen Aktienmärkten rund um den Globus. Um diese Chancen so schnell wie möglich nutzen zu können, müssen sehr große Datenmengen mit extrem niedrigen Latenzzeiten verarbeitet und gelagert werden. Sobald das Handelssignal erzeugt wird, übernimmt die intelligente Auftragsausführung, um einen möglichen Schlupf zu minimieren. Pairs Trading Dieser Client verwendet AlgoTrader, um die Performance einer großen Anzahl historisch korrelierter Sicherheitspaare zu überwachen. Wenn die Korrelation zwischen zwei Wertpapieren eine vorübergehende Schwäche zeigt, wird ein Paarhandel eröffnet, indem der Outperforming-Bestand kurzgefaßt wird und der Underperforming-Bestand weitgehend überschritten wird. Die Strategie nutzt die AlgoTrader Pair Trading Lab Integration, um Kandidatenpaare aus einer Datenbank von mehr als 10 Millionen voranalysierten US-Aktienpaaren auszuwählen. Volatilitätshandel Diese Strategie setzt sich aus mehreren Teilstrategien mit unterschiedlicher Komplexität und Handelshäufigkeit zusammen. Während verschiedene Module identische Instrumente (basierend auf einer anderen Logik) handeln können, können diese Module auf einer Tick-by-Tick-Basis miteinander kommunizieren, ohne komplexe Risikolimite auf Portfolioebene zu überschreiten. Social Media Trading Dieser Client hat einen proprietären Algorithmus entwickelt, der es ermöglicht, die Web-und Social Media in Echtzeit für Informationen, die verwendet werden können, um die Sicherheit Preisgestaltung vorherzusagen. Dazu werden große Datenverarbeitung, semantische Analyse und maschinelles Lernen verwendet, um die Änderungen im Inhalt virtueller Konversationen abzubilden und diese auf Änderungen der Sicherheitspreise zu beziehen, indem die Algorithmen anhand von historischen Daten trainiert werden. Das Client-Modell kann Änderungen in der Wertpapierbewertung vorhersagen, die dann mit AlgoTrader gehandelt werden. Market Making Dieser Kunde engagiert sich in selektiven Markt-Making über die Anzahl der Börsen und Instrumente mit einem proprietären Preismodell. Ein wichtiger Bestandteil der Strategieimplementierung war die Erstellung eines anspruchsvollen Risikomanagementsystems, das die Überwachung der Exposure über den Instrumententyp, die Währung, das Konto und das Portfolio ermöglicht. Makro / Sondersituation Unser Kunde benötigte eine rasche Umsetzung einer spezifischen Strategie, um eine lukrative und dennoch kurzlebige Chance zu nutzen, die durch die makroökonomischen Rahmenbedingungen geschaffen wurde. Das Modell handelte sowohl Futures und Optionen auf verschiedene Zeitrahmen in Kombination mit kontinuierlichen Hecken. Die Strategie wurde innerhalb weniger Tage erfolgreich umgesetzt und lieferte die erwarteten Ergebnisse. Um mit der Implementierung der spezifischen Handelsstrategie Ihres Unternehmens mit AlgoTrader zu diskutieren, wenden Sie sich an unsere Mitarbeiter im.
No comments:
Post a Comment